Beyond Compare 5密钥生成技术解密:从逆向工程到实战激活
还在为Beyond Compare 5的授权验证而困扰?这款被誉为文件对比神器的软件,其精密的授权机制让许多技术爱好者望而却步。今天,我们将从技术角度深度剖析密钥生成的完整流程,带您掌握从原理到实践的全面技术方案。
核心技术原理:逆向工程的智慧结晶
通过深入分析Beyond Compare 5的二进制文件,我们发现软件采用了一套复杂的RSA密钥验证机制。在地址范围0F1:24C0到0F1:2670的内存区域中,存在关键字节序列2B 2B 31 31,这些正是授权验证的核心标识。
密钥生成过程遵循严谨的技术逻辑:
- 密钥对构建:生成符合软件验证标准的RSA密钥对
- 数据结构编码:按照特定算法对用户信息进行编码处理
- 数字签名生成:使用优化后的私钥对编码数据进行签名
- 格式标准化封装:将签名结果封装为软件可识别的密钥格式
实战操作指南:多模式密钥生成方案
Web界面模式:零门槛快速上手
启动本地Web服务后,您将看到一个直观的密钥生成界面:
在表单中填写以下参数:
- 用户名:显示在授权信息中的使用者标识
- 组织名称:关联的企业或团队信息
- 序列号:用于区分不同授权的唯一标识
- 生成数量:控制同时使用的用户上限
命令行模式:高效批量处理
对于需要批量生成或集成到自动化流程的技术用户,命令行模式提供了更高的灵活性:
python3 keygen.py --username "技术团队" --company "研发中心" --max-users 8
通过参数组合,您可以快速生成满足不同场景需求的授权密钥。
软件激活全流程:从生成到验证
第一步:识别授权状态
当Beyond Compare 5显示"30天评估期"错误时,表明需要输入有效的授权密钥:
第二步:输入生成密钥
在弹出的授权窗口中,粘贴通过工具生成的完整许可证密钥:
第三步:验证激活结果
激活成功后,"关于"窗口将显示完整的授权信息:
高级技术要点:深入理解密钥机制
版本兼容性深度解析
| 软件版本 | 支持状态 | 技术原理分析 |
|---|---|---|
| 5.0.x系列 | ✅ 完全兼容 | 基于RSA-2048位加密验证 |
| 5.1.x系列 | ✅ 完全兼容 | 签名算法保持一致 |
| 6.0及以上 | ❌ 算法升级 | 需等待技术更新 |
密钥数据结构剖析
每个生成的授权密钥包含多个技术层级:
- 头部标识:
--- BEGIN LICENSE KEY ---标准格式 - 编码数据:经过Base64编码的签名信息
- 元信息封装:版本号、随机值、用户参数等
常见技术问题解决方案
环境配置类问题
Q:Python依赖安装失败?
A:确认Python版本≥3.8,使用国内镜像源加速:pip3 install -r requirements.txt -i https://pypi.tuna.tsinghua.edu.cn/simple
平台特定技术问题
Windows系统技术要点:
- 部分安全软件可能误判为风险行为
- 建议以普通用户权限执行操作
- 如遇拦截,可临时关闭实时防护功能
macOS系统技术要点:
- 如提示文件损坏,执行:
sudo xattr -rd com.apple.quarantine /Applications/Beyond\ Compare.app
最佳技术实践建议
- 技术更新追踪:关注项目的技术演进,及时获取新版本支持
- 数据安全备份:操作前备份相关配置文件
- 合规使用原则:在个人学习和研究范围内合理使用
技术价值深度思考
该密钥生成工具的核心技术价值在于对Beyond Compare 5授权机制的深度理解。通过逆向工程技术,成功解析了软件的密钥验证流程,并实现了相应的生成算法。
整个过程体现了技术探索的多个维度:
- 二进制数据分析能力
- 加密算法应用深度
- 数据结构转换技术
- 签名验证机制理解
技术展望与总结
通过本文的技术深度解析,您已经全面掌握了Beyond Compare 5密钥生成的技术原理与实战方法。无论是通过直观的Web界面还是高效的命令行操作,都能快速获得有效的授权密钥。
记住,技术工具的真正价值在于帮助我们更深入地理解软件运行机制。在探索开源技术的同时,也要尊重软件开发者的知识产权,为构建健康的技术生态贡献力量。
现在,让我们一起开启Beyond Compare 5的技术探索之旅,深入理解软件授权的技术奥秘!
Kimi-K2.5Kimi K2.5 是一款开源的原生多模态智能体模型,它在 Kimi-K2-Base 的基础上,通过对约 15 万亿混合视觉和文本 tokens 进行持续预训练构建而成。该模型将视觉与语言理解、高级智能体能力、即时模式与思考模式,以及对话式与智能体范式无缝融合。Python00- QQwen3-Coder-Next2026年2月4日,正式发布的Qwen3-Coder-Next,一款专为编码智能体和本地开发场景设计的开源语言模型。Python00
xw-cli实现国产算力大模型零门槛部署,一键跑通 Qwen、GLM-4.7、Minimax-2.1、DeepSeek-OCR 等模型Go06
PaddleOCR-VL-1.5PaddleOCR-VL-1.5 是 PaddleOCR-VL 的新一代进阶模型,在 OmniDocBench v1.5 上实现了 94.5% 的全新 state-of-the-art 准确率。 为了严格评估模型在真实物理畸变下的鲁棒性——包括扫描伪影、倾斜、扭曲、屏幕拍摄和光照变化——我们提出了 Real5-OmniDocBench 基准测试集。实验结果表明,该增强模型在新构建的基准测试集上达到了 SOTA 性能。此外,我们通过整合印章识别和文本检测识别(text spotting)任务扩展了模型的能力,同时保持 0.9B 的超紧凑 VLM 规模,具备高效率特性。Python00
KuiklyUI基于KMP技术的高性能、全平台开发框架,具备统一代码库、极致易用性和动态灵活性。 Provide a high-performance, full-platform development framework with unified codebase, ultimate ease of use, and dynamic flexibility. 注意:本仓库为Github仓库镜像,PR或Issue请移步至Github发起,感谢支持!Kotlin08
VLOOKVLOOK™ 是优雅好用的 Typora/Markdown 主题包和增强插件。 VLOOK™ is an elegant and practical THEME PACKAGE × ENHANCEMENT PLUGIN for Typora/Markdown.Less00






